Break-glass access: Thumbnail generation queue (Glimmerbox). Normal ops: workers auto-scale; don't touch. Break-glass applies only when the queue backs up past 2M items and the dashboard is unreachable. Steps: page the media-infra lead, open an incident, then use the emergency console on the Farrowgate bastion. The console prompt asks for two things: your incident number and the standing recovery passphrase. Both are mandatory. The current recovery passphrase is recorded immediately below for authorized responders.

strongbox words: sorir-belvan-rusix-ulays-ralmir-praix-eliir-tamax-praael-druael-julir-tamius-jorir

## Shrinkwrap CLI 1.8.0

Batch resize now streams files instead of loading the whole set into memory, fixing OOM crashes on large runs. Added `--max-workers` and progress output suitable for log scraping. Failed images are skipped and listed at exit rather than aborting the batch. For escalations during this rollout, contact the engineer listed below.

account owner for bawip-tahag: Raleth Quenok

- [ ] **Step 7: Breaker override escrow.** After sealing the signing keys for the Tallgrove upstream API circuit breaker, confirm the support team can force the breaker open during a full outage. The override bundle lives in the sealed escrow drawer and is useless without its unlock phrase. Two ceremony witnesses must initial this step before proceeding. The escrow bundle is decrypted with the recovery passphrase that follows.

vault phrase of kahip-kahop = holath-quenmir

## Authentication

The payroll export format changed in v4: exports are now streamed as chunked NDJSON from the internal Ledgerline service instead of batch CSV. Ledgerline requires a service key on every request, passed in the request header. Keys rotate monthly; the on-call engineer is responsible for swapping the key in the exporter's environment file and restarting the worker. If exports fail with a 401, rotation is the first thing to check. The current Ledgerline key is shown below.

service key, kawip-kahop: kto4_QQzB